History publishing at I.B.Tauris is driven by core principles of scholarly excellence combined with innovative and exciting writing. Our list contains both academic works – ranging from major works of scholarship and student textbooks, to monographs and edited collections – and a diverse collection of stimulating histories for the general reader. I.B.Tauris’ history publishing is global in scope, covering the ancient and medieval worlds and the modern age, in particular the twentieth century. Guided by an advisory board of scholars drawn from the leading research institutions worldwide, our strategy allows for close involvement with authors’ work.
